Setúbal, a city 40kms south of the capital, Lisbon. In a city with around 115.000 habitants, there is a clandestine neighborhood, that still inherits the problems of the people from the former colonies, who came to Portugal in search of a better life.As a consequence from the Covid-19 pandemic, many of these residents became unemployed and feel they have been forgotten by the city.To make matters worse, in February of 2020, some of these houses were demolished by the authorities due to safety and health concerns. the residents rebuild the houses every time they get demolished.
